The Occupational Health Physician is responsible for overseeing the health and well-being of all employees, with a specific focus on managing occupational health risks, promoting wellness programs, and ensuring a safe work environment. This role requires a blend of medical expertise and a strong understanding of the unique challenges and regulations of the hospitality and gaming industries. The Occupational Health Physician will collaborate with management, the safety and security department, and HR to promote a healthy workforce and reduce work-related injuries or illnesses.

Job Description:

Employee Health Management:

  • Provide medical assessments for employees, including pre-employment health evaluations, return-to-work assessments, and ongoing health evaluations for those in high-risk positions.
  • Diagnose and treat work-related injuries or illnesses, offering immediate care or referring employees to specialists as necessary.
  • Monitor and manage occupational health risks, including exposure to hazardous substances, repetitive motion injuries, and physical or mental stressors specific to hotel and casino operations.
  • Develop and maintain a system for tracking employee injuries and illnesses, ensuring compliance with workplace safety regulations.

Health and Safety Programs:

  • Design, implement, and monitor wellness programs that promote employee health, reduce absenteeism, and encourage healthy behaviors.
  • Conduct health and safety risk assessments, especially for employees working in areas with heightened risks, such as food service, casino floors, and maintenance.
  • Provide training and education on health-related topics, such as ergonomics, stress management, substance abuse prevention, and proper use of personal protective equipment (PPE).

Compliance & Regulations:

  • Ensure compliance with local occupational health regulations
  • Prepare and maintain reports related to occupational health and safety, including injury logs, accident investigations, and regulatory inspections.
  • Advise management on the development of policies and procedures to maintain a healthy and safe workplace in compliance with industry regulations.

Collaborative Health Services:

  • Work closely with the Safety & Security team to manage workplace incidents, handle employee medical leave, and support employees' mental and physical health needs.
  • Provide medical consultation and support for employee wellness initiatives, such as smoking cessation programs, fitness challenges, and stress reduction programs.
  • Conduct post-incident health assessments to evaluate the impact of accidents or incidents and develop plans for recovery and reintegration.

Emergency Response & First Aid:

  • Serve as the lead medical responder in case of workplace emergencies, ensuring swift and appropriate medical care is provided.
  • Provide first aid and emergency medical care to employees as necessary, and coordinate with external healthcare providers for follow-up treatment if needed.
  • Ensure that emergency medical protocols and first-aid procedures are regularly updated, practiced, and compliant with workplace safety standards.

Health Promotion & Employee Engagement:

  • Foster a proactive approach to employee well-being by identifying potential health risks before they become significant issues.
  • Organize and oversee health screenings (e.g., flu shots, blood pressure checks) and health education workshops for employees.
  • Promote mental health awareness, encourage healthy work-life balance, and reduce employee stress and burnout, particularly in a high-stress environment like a hotel and casino.

Data Collection & Reporting:

  • Track and analyze trends in employee health, including common illnesses, injuries, and occupational hazards.
  • Maintain confidential employee medical records in compliance with the company policies, and the National Privacy Commission.
  • Prepare reports for the management regarding the overall health of the workforce, patterns in absenteeism, and areas for improvement in occupational health practices.
